Silk Road Travelogue: Photos of Historic Kashgar and Spectacular Drive Through the Karakoram Highway to Tashkurgan

In this third part of a fascinating photo-filled travelogue, Ali Karim takes our readers to historic sites in Kashgar including China’s biggest mosque, the mausoleum of a banished Uyghur, the Old Town with its narrow winding streets and old buildings, and the town’s Grand Bazaar. He also mentions about a Kashgar family’s warm hospitality, and visits a tea house, restaurants and some of the city’s metalwork and musical industries. Finally, readers are treated to photos of snow-capped mountains on the Karakoram Highway, as Ali and Dilshad head up to the town of Tashkurgan for the last leg of their stay in China.
